It depends on your definition of 'project'...

If you are using Collector to add features to a feature service, you can absolutely, 100% edit the same feature service using ArcPad: ArcPad Help

ArcPad is not able to use your pop-up definitions - but you will get a set of default ArcPad forms that you can customize to your hearts content You will still have the option to sync your edits back to the feature service in the field, or store edits locally.

So yes, you can edit the same data with both products - it will just be preparing the projects for the field that will be different.
